Overview

Solar panel cleaning tools are essential for maintaining the performance of photovoltaic systems. Accumulated dirt or debris can reduce energy output by up to 25%, making regular cleaning a critical maintenance task. These tools range from manual brushes to automated robotic systems, designed to suit different installation environments like rooftops, solar farms, or off-grid setups. Innovations in cleaning tools include water-fed poles with purified water systems to prevent mineral deposits and robotic cleaners for large-scale solar farms. The choice of tool depends on factors such as panel tilt, location, and the level of soiling. Professional-grade tools prioritize efficiency and safety, minimizing damage to delicate panel surfaces.

Structure and Working Principle

Manual cleaning tools typically consist of an extendable pole with a soft-bristle brush or sponge head, often paired with a water sprayer. The bristles are designed to dislodge dirt without scratching the panel’s anti-reflective coating. For automated systems, robotic cleaners use rotating brushes or microfiber strips, powered by built-in motors or solar energy, and may include sensors to navigate panel arrays. Water-fed systems employ deionized water to avoid streaks, while some advanced tools integrate electrostatic or air-blowing mechanisms for waterless cleaning. The working principle centers on gentle yet effective debris removal while ensuring minimal water usage and labor costs, especially in arid regions.

Key Features

High-quality solar panel cleaning tools prioritize durability and panel safety. Non-abrasive materials like nylon or silicone bristles prevent surface damage, while lightweight aluminum or carbon fiber poles enhance portability. Telescopic designs allow adjustments for hard-to-reach panels, and some tools feature angled heads for tilted installations. Automated tools offer programmable cleaning schedules and self-charging capabilities, ideal for utility-scale projects. Water filtration systems in professional tools eliminate impurities that could leave residues. Ergonomics is another critical feature, reducing operator fatigue during frequent use.

Application Areas

These tools are used across residential, commercial, and industrial solar installations. Rooftop systems often require compact, manual tools with extension poles, while solar farms benefit from tractor-mounted or robotic cleaners to handle vast arrays efficiently. Desert installations face unique challenges like sand accumulation, necessitating robust brushing systems. Off-grid solar setups in remote areas may rely on portable, water-efficient tools. Additionally, tools with chemical compatibility are selected for panels exposed to pollutants or algal growth. The application scope continues to expand with the growth of floating solar farms, demanding corrosion-resistant designs.

Maintenance and Precautions

Regular inspection of cleaning tools is vital to prevent wear that could damage panels. Replace worn bristles or frayed components promptly, and rinse brushes after use to avoid grit buildup. For water-fed systems, maintain filters to ensure water purity and prevent clogging. Avoid harsh chemicals or high-pressure washers, which can degrade panel coatings. Clean panels during cooler hours to prevent thermal shock, and ensure electrical safety by disconnecting systems if required. Store tools in dry conditions to prolong lifespan.

B2B Procurement Guide

B2B buyers should evaluate tools based on scalability, durability, and total cost of ownership. Bulk purchases of manual tools may suit small installers, while large operators might invest in automated systems for long-term savings. Request certifications for materials to guarantee panel compatibility. Supplier reliability is critical; prioritize vendors with proven after-sales support and warranties. Compare energy efficiency ratings for robotic cleaners. For global procurement, consider shipping costs and local service availability. Sample testing is recommended to assess tool performance under site-specific conditions.
